This commit is contained in:
yumoqing 2026-03-25 18:34:13 +08:00
parent 248a5e11dc
commit f7a7d6ca48

View File

@ -145,7 +145,7 @@ def check_value(field, spec_value, data_value):
if field.value_mode == 'in': if field.value_mode == 'in':
arr = spec_value.split(' ') arr = spec_value.split(' ')
arr = [ typevalue(a, field.type) for a in arr ] arr = [ typevalue(a, field.type) for a in arr ]
debug(f'{arr=}, {data_value=}') # debug(f'{arr=}, {data_value=}')
return data_value in arr return data_value in arr
mode = field.value_mode mode = field.value_mode
@ -362,6 +362,7 @@ order by b.enabled_date desc"""
exception(e) exception(e)
raise Exception(e) raise Exception(e)
debug(f'{formula=}, {ns=}, {p=}, {d.fields=}') debug(f'{formula=}, {ns=}, {p=}, {d.fields=}')
np.update(ns)
np.amount = eval(formula, ns) np.amount = eval(formula, ns)
ret_items.append(np) ret_items.append(np)
if len(ret_items) == 0: if len(ret_items) == 0: